Lifelong Readers Announce 2027 Schedule

COLUSA, CA (MPG) – The Lifelong Readers Book Club has announced its 2027 reading schedule, with eight books planned for discussion from January through November.

The club meets from 6 to 7 p.m. at Colusa Taproom, 121 Eighth St. Meetings generally take place on the second Monday of each month and are open to the public.

The schedule begins Jan. 11 with “The Correspondent” by Virginia Evans, followed by “Kin” by Tayari Jones on Feb. 8 and “The Calamity Club” by Heather Stockett on March 8.

Other selections include “The Black Count” by Thomas Reiss on April 12 and “The Things We Never Say” by Elizabeth Strout on May 10.

The club will take a summer break before returning Sept. 13 with “The Lion Women of Tehran” by Marjan Kamali. “Raja the Gullible” by Rabih Alameddine is scheduled for Oct. 11, followed by “The Demon of Unrest” by Erik Larson on Nov. 8.
